#d5d4f1 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d5d4f1 is composed of 83.5% red, 83.1% green and 94.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.6% cyan, 12%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 242.1 degrees, a saturation of 50.9% and a lightness of 88.8%. #d5d4f1 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#aba9e3. Closest websafe color is: #ccccff.

Shades and Tints of #d5d4f1

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000001 is the darkest color, while #f2f2fb is the lightest one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#d5d4f1 is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#d8d8d8 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#d7d7dd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#d4d7f2 Protanopia 1% of men
  • #dfd3f2 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#d5d8e7 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#d4d5f1 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#dbd3f2 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#d5d6ea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
